🥚Glasgow's History: A Comedy Walking Tour! 🥚
**What Is The Event?**
Join two of Scotland’s finest comedians for a historical tour like no other, a journey through the history of Scotland’s largest city, with laughs abound.
Want to hear the funny stories behind Glasgow driving the world forward during the Industrial Revolution?
Interested in the city’s founder, St Mungo, and want to know about his miracles?
Glasgow is a city like no other, and we want to show it off to new arrivals, visitors, and even locals, come find out the true hilarious story of your home town.
Ross Leslie and Kathleen Hughes are professional comedians, who also perform historical comedy shows, and do professional walking tours around the country.

**Important Information**
📢 We are limited to 20 patrons per time slot, so book fast!
⌚The tour will begin at 10.00am at Duke of Wellington Statue, and will finish at midday at Glasgow Green.
☂️ The tour will be outdoors, and it is March, and it is the west of Scotland, so please be dressed for all weather conditions.
😂 The tour is recommended for 14+ as there will be “adult” comedy material.
